Understanding Heat Conductivity: Glass vs. Metal

The core of the debate lies in the way glass and metal conduct heat. Metal heats up quickly and evenly, distributing warmth rapidly throughout the dough. This results in a consistent bake with a well-defined crust. Think of it as a sprint – metal gets up to speed quickly.

Glass, on the other hand, is a poor conductor of heat compared to metal. It heats slowly but retains heat for a longer duration. This means that while the surface of the glass might reach the target temperature quickly, it takes longer for the heat to penetrate and evenly cook the dough, which is like a marathon runner – steady and long-lasting.

This difference in heat conductivity can impact the final product in several ways. A metal pan will generally yield a loaf with a crisper, more golden-brown crust, while a glass pan may result in a softer crust. The baking time may also need adjustments depending on the type of pan you use.

The Potential Risks of Baking Bread in Glass Pans

While glass pans are perfectly safe for baking bread under certain conditions, it’s important to understand the risks involved.

Thermal Shock and Shattering

Perhaps the biggest concern is the risk of thermal shock. Thermal shock occurs when a glass pan experiences a sudden and drastic temperature change. This can happen when transferring a cold glass pan directly into a preheated oven or placing a hot pan on a cold surface. The rapid expansion and contraction can cause the glass to shatter, leading to a mess and potentially dangerous situation. Always allow the glass pan to reach room temperature before placing it in the oven or adding cold ingredients to it.

Different types of glass have different resistance to thermal shock. Tempered glass, commonly used in bakeware, is designed to withstand higher temperatures and rapid temperature changes compared to regular glass. However, even tempered glass is not immune to thermal shock, especially if it has any existing chips or cracks.

Tips for Successfully Baking Bread in Glass Pans

Despite the potential risks, baking bread in a glass pan can be done successfully with the right precautions and adjustments.

Choosing the Right Glass Pan

Not all glass pans are created equal. When baking bread, opt for a tempered glass pan specifically designed for baking. These pans are more resistant to thermal shock and can withstand higher oven temperatures. Avoid using thin or delicate glass pans, as they are more prone to shattering.

Gradual Temperature Changes

The key to avoiding thermal shock is to introduce the glass pan to temperature changes gradually. Avoid placing a cold glass pan directly into a preheated oven. Instead, let the pan come to room temperature before placing it in the oven. You can also preheat the pan along with the oven, allowing it to warm up gradually. Similarly, when removing the baked bread from the oven, avoid placing the hot pan on a cold surface like a granite countertop. Use a trivet or a thick cloth to insulate the pan from the cold surface.

Adjusting Baking Time and Temperature

Glass pans tend to retain heat more efficiently than metal pans. Therefore, it is often recommended to reduce the oven temperature by 25°F (15°C) when using a glass pan. This helps to prevent the bottom of the bread from overcooking while the center cooks through. You might also need to adjust the baking time. Start checking the bread for doneness a few minutes earlier than the recipe suggests. A toothpick inserted into the center of the loaf should come out clean or with a few moist crumbs attached.

Proper Greasing and Flouring

Proper greasing and flouring are crucial when baking bread in any pan, but it’s especially important with glass pans. Thoroughly grease the pan with butter, shortening, or cooking spray, ensuring that all surfaces are coated. Then, dust the greased pan with flour, tapping out any excess. This will help the bread release easily from the pan and prevent sticking. Parchment paper is another alternative to lining the pan.

Monitoring Internal Temperature

Using a digital thermometer to check the internal temperature of the bread is the most accurate way to determine doneness. The ideal internal temperature for most breads is between 190°F (88°C) and 210°F (99°C). Insert the thermometer into the center of the loaf, avoiding the bottom of the pan, to get an accurate reading.

Types of Bread and Glass Pan Suitability

The type of bread you are baking can also influence whether a glass pan is a suitable choice.

Loaf Breads

For loaf breads like sandwich bread, banana bread, or zucchini bread, a glass pan can work well, especially if you follow the tips mentioned above. However, be mindful of the potential for a softer crust and adjust the baking time and temperature accordingly.

Artisan Breads

Artisan breads, such as sourdough or crusty Italian loaves, typically require high heat and a very crisp crust. In these cases, a metal pan, baking stone, or Dutch oven is usually preferred over a glass pan. The faster heat conductivity of metal promotes a better crust development.

Quick Breads

Quick breads, like muffins and scones, can be baked in glass pans, but again, be aware of the slower heat conductivity. Consider using individual glass ramekins for smaller portions to ensure even baking.

What are the advantages of using a glass pan for baking bread?

Glass pans have a unique advantage: you can easily monitor the browning of the bread’s bottom crust. This is because glass is transparent and allows you to see how the crust is developing without removing the loaf from the oven. This can be particularly helpful for achieving the desired color and preventing a soggy bottom, especially with enriched doughs that tend to brown faster.

Another benefit of glass pans is their ability to retain heat well. This can help ensure even baking throughout the loaf, preventing hot spots and ensuring a consistent texture. However, this heat retention can also mean that the bread continues to cook even after it’s removed from the oven, so it’s crucial to monitor the internal temperature and remove the bread when it’s slightly underdone to prevent it from drying out.

How do I prevent my glass pan from breaking when baking bread?

Preventing thermal shock is crucial to avoiding breakage. Avoid drastic temperature changes. Never place a cold glass pan in a hot oven or a hot glass pan on a cold surface. Always allow the pan to warm up gradually as the oven preheats and cool down slowly on a wire rack after baking. Avoid adding cold liquids to a hot glass pan.

Ensure you are using oven-safe glass. Most modern glass bakeware is designed to withstand oven temperatures, but it’s always best to check the manufacturer’s instructions and temperature limits. Avoid using damaged or chipped glass pans, as these are more susceptible to cracking under heat. Consider the weight of the dough; exceptionally heavy doughs may put added stress on the glass during baking, especially at higher temperatures.
